Yusuke hagihara was a japanese astronomer noted for his contributions to celestial mechanics. Named in honor of yusuke hagihara 18971979, professor of astronomy at the university of tokyo from 1935 to 1957, director of the tokyo observatory from 1946 to 1957, and long an inspiring leader and teacher, principally in celestial mechanics and also in several other branches of astronomy and.
